The dip in CoralRX took all of the color out of the SPS. They were fine after acclimating, but they came out bleached out of the CoralRX. Luckily, I read a thread recently where the same thing happened to someone else, and their SPS colored back up after awhile. They have good polyp extension at the moment, so I'm hoping I'll be as lucky.

a little anecdote... My clam kept falling off of the pedestal. At first it'd be fine for most of the day, then a few hours, and then it'd be off the pedestal 15 minutes after I replaced it. I, of course, was getting frustrated that I couldn't orient it in a way it would be satisfied with.

 

Well while I was placing frags in the tank last night, I placed the clam on the pedestal. Moments later, Mr. BSJ decides to push it off with his mouth! That little bugger! I set it back on this morning and set up the camera. The clam has been on the pedestal all day long. GRRR!!!! Mr. BSJ outwits me again.

Thanks 125!

 

I got most of them from Mr. Coral and several pieces from vivid aquariums (my LFS)

 

I dip all corals in revive. I drip acclimate first (airline tubing with a cheap airline valve at the end), and then add Coral RX after the acclimation process is over. The frags go straight from the CoralRX and into the tank after that.

My jawfish spends a LOT of time outside of his house. He is completely unfazed by my presence, and will even swim up to me. He hasn't made any burrows anywhere else, and will retreat to his main house if feels threatened. I'd probably say he spends half of his time hanging outside of his house. I caught earlier today exploring the frag racks. I added a couple of feather dusters. I was covering the tubes with sand and happened to look up and see him checking out what I was doing. I think I really got lucky with with my jawfish. It's also funny to watch him interact with the other fish. He will threaten them with his open mouth if they are in his area... He does something my last jawfish didn't do. He'll puff water at the fish push them away. It's cute with the little clowns as they are so tiny.
